Review and Outlook on Concept "Lucid Waters and Lush Mountains Are Invaluable Assets" at Its 20th Anniversary: Scientific Connotation, Strategic Value, and Case Study-Case Study

Abstract

Improving the mechanism for realizing the value of ecological products is a crucial approach to implementing the concept that “lucid waters and lush mountains are invaluable assets,” and it holds significant importance for promoting the transformation of ecological value and the green transition of the economy and society. As China’s first pilot city for the ecological product value realization mechanism, Lishui City has consistently innovated in gross ecosystem product (GEP) accounting and the application of its outcomes, offering a model and reference for nationwide ecological product value realization. This study systematically examines Lishui’s exemplary practices in ecological product value realization across three dimensions: GEP accounting, application of accounting results, and safeguarding mechanisms. The findings demonstrate that Lishui has established a progressive framework of “standardized accounting—multi-scenario application—institutional safeguarding,” achieving full coverage of GEP accounting at the municipal, county, township, and village levels. It has pioneered the integration of GEP accounting results into strategic planning, economic development, ecological regulation, and performance evaluation, while establishing a robust safeguard mechanism for GEP application. Nonetheless, challenges still remain, such as an immature natural resource asset ownership system, insufficient market investment enthusiasm, difficulties in spontaneously forming effective trading markets for ecological assets and products, and limited financial institution participation. The study recommends further rationally defining the attribution of rights and responsibilities of ecological products, promoting market-oriented ecological product development, and exploring green finance innovation models to advance innovative practices.
